Pyrolobus fumarii is a hyperthermophile, which is rod shaped and is physiologically different from Thermoproteales. Thermoproteales is an obligate anaerobe whereas Pyrolobus fumarii is aerobic in nature. However, Pyrolobus fumarii also shows anaerobic respiration mechanism with NO3-, S0, or Fe3+ as electron acceptors and H2 as electron donor.
